天津宝坻区工地人行通道闸口人脸识别机参数如何设置
使用python3+写的,使用face_recognition(python开源的人脸识别库)进行人脸识别 ,使用opencv2进行打开显示摄像头图片等,使用pyqt5是ui界面,使用百度AI中的百度语音合成实现语音播报和语音合成,使用对excel的操作以及人脸识别实现模拟签到。
只需要把一张具有人脸信息的图片按名字命名放到相应的文件夹中,在text.txt文本中输入详细信息,即可使用。
面部识别机通过高级算法和模型进行人脸属性分析。这些分析通常包括以下几个方面:
1)年龄和性别预测:面部识别机使用专门的模型来预测人脸的年龄和性别。例如,DeepFace系统的年龄预测模型平均对误差为 +/- 4.6岁,而性别预测模型的准确率达到97%。
2)情绪识别:通过分析面部表情,机器能够识别出人的情绪状态,如愤怒、快乐等。
3)面部特征点定位:定位面部的关键特征点,如眼睛、鼻子、嘴巴等,这有助于更准确地分析面部属性。
4)其他属性分析:除了基本的年龄和性别外,面部识别机还能检测是否佩戴眼镜、头部姿态、是否闭眼等多种属性。
在进行人脸属性分析时,面部识别机会先侦测脸部区域,然后对脸部方向进行调整,接着将图片数据化以便训练,通过比对数据库中的数据找到图片相似度,从而完成识别和分析过程。
人脸对齐技术通过将人脸图像标准化,可以提高人脸识别的效率。这项技术的重要性主要体现在以下几个方面:
1)提高识别准确率:人脸对齐通过几何变换将不同姿态、表情和照明条件下的人脸特征标准化,从而减少这些因素对识别结果的影响。
2)统一特征尺度:通过对图像进行缩放、旋转和平移,人脸对齐技术能够统一不同尺度的人脸特征,使得后续的特征提取和比对更加方便和准确。
3)去除干扰因素:人脸对齐过程中可以对图像进行修复和填充,去除遮挡物和噪声等干扰因素,提高识别精度。
4)便于后续处理:经过对齐处理的人脸图像更加规范化,简化了特征提取过程,提高了特征提取的效率。
5)提高识别速度:通过减小图像差异,人脸对齐技术可以加快识别速度,是在需要处理大量人脸图像时,这一点尤为重要。
总的来说,人脸对齐技术是人脸识别流程中的关键步骤,它通过减少图像之间的差异,为的人脸识别奠定了基础
安装与部署:
在执行人脸识别设备的安装与部署过程中,需确保以下几点:
1. 选择合适的安装位置:通常情况下,应保证摄像头能有效捕捉到人脸,以保证识别的准确性。
2. 设备供电:连接设备至电源,并确保设备正常启动。
3. 网络连接:根据设备需求,接入网络,以便于数据上传或实现远程管理。